Job summary

We are looking for nurses to join our team. You should be experienced in palliative care and be looking for an opportunity to work with us in delivering exceptional palliative care to our patients.

Main duties of the job

To be responsible for the care, assessment and support of patients and their families with life limiting illnesses who are attending for end of life care or symptom control.

To asses, plan, implement and evaluate care within sphere of responsibility.

To assist in the management and organisation of work in the clinical area.

To always act in a manner consistent with the NMC Code of Professional Conduct carrying out their duties in accordance with Hospice policies and procedures.

Job description

Clinical Responsibilities

Actively promote best practice, ensuring all care is evidence based.

Assess, plan, implement and evaluate clinical care of patients. Pass on information to multi-disciplinary team. To act as a named nurse for a group of patients within your team.

Professionally responsible for adherence to Hospice policies and procedures.

Participate in audits of practice and clinical effectiveness and practice developments.

Medicines Management assist in maintaining custody of controlled drugs, checking and witnessing of administration of drugs according to Hospice Policy and in line with the NMC Standards for the Administration of Medicine.

Carry out nursing procedures and treatments in accordance with approved guidelines, which are research and evidence based.

Maintain accurate electronica records and ensure these records are clear and concise and are in accordance with the NMC Standards for Records and Record Keeping.

Ensure timely completion of all risk assessments .

Liaise with other members of MDT by attending MDT meetings and ward rounds at directions of the nurse in charge.

Responsible for the safe handling and storage of patients valuables.

Ensure admission and discharge policies adhere to Hospice policies.

Support clinical governance systems and ensure care is delivered appropriately.

Provide support for new members of staff as part of their induction.

Ordering of supplies when necessary, promoting cost effectiveness and efficiency.

Possess clinical knowledge appropriate to Palliative Care, and provide this knowledge when responsible for the 24 Hour Palliative Care Advice Line as per rota. Keep up to date with new developments.

Recognise a deteriorating patient and escalate appropriately according to the plan of care.

Responsive to patients needs including those with special needs and/or learning disabilities.

Able to deal sensitively with terminally ill patients and their relatives.

Use own professional judgement when assessing patient needs and involving more senior colleagues when appropriate.

Organise own time effectively and that of junior staff and learners.

Ensure accuracy when delivering treatments and/or procedures.

To provide cover for colleagues as directed by your manager.

Demonstrate a willingness to work in all areas, night duty, day duty as required.

About us

Willow Wood Hospice is an adult hospice providing care for patients with life limiting conditions. We care for these adults by providing symptom control and end of life care. The needs of the patients and their families are at the heart of all we do.
